WOrk Experience Education
The Board of Education believes that work experience education programs can provide students with valuable instruction in the skills, attitudes and understandings they need in order to be successfully employed.
In order that they may strike a proper balance between work experience and academic instruction, juniors and seniors may receive a maximum of 20 credits of work experience (10 per semester) in their junior or senior year.
Emphasis will be placed on screening employees for meaningful work experience. Work experience should encourage a career focus.
The Superintendent or designee shall ensure that the work experience education program meets all of the requirements of law governing these programs.
